At 24 Highgate Ct in Kensington, CA, Property Advisor Amanda Steele and agent Ruth Frassetto of The Grubb Co. partnered to help a homeowner prepare his property for sale. He had purchased the home in 2018 and completed some upgrades but recognized the need for additional improvements, including landscaping and cosmetic updates, to fully maximize its value. Referred to Revive by his Realtor, Ruth Presedo, Matt embraced the opportunity to elevate his home’s appeal in the competitive market.
The results speak for themselves.
The $258,756 renovation included targeted updates designed to enhance the property’s overall aesthetic. Flooring was replaced to create a cohesive interior, while the bathrooms were remodeled to modern standards. Interior painting and wallpaper removal refreshed the living spaces, and deck repairs improved the outdoor appeal. New doors and installations completed the updates, creating a polished and welcoming home for prospective buyers.
The property sold for $2,700,000, resulting in a $441,244 net profit for the seller and a 171% return on investment. Ruth, working with Revive for the first time, saw a 35% increase in commission and a smooth process that allowed her to focus on her client.
